Air-fried Croissants make the best croutons. Crispy, buttery, and golden, these croissant croutons are perfect for adding a special touch to salads, soups, and even pastas.
To make air-fried croissant croutons, start by preheating your air fryer to 350°F (175°C). While the air fryer is heating up, slice the croissants into small cubes, about ½ inch in size.
Next, place the croissant cubes into a mixing bowl and drizzle them with olive oil. Toss the cubes gently to make sure they are evenly coated with the oil.
Once the air fryer is hot, transfer the croissant cubes into the air fryer basket, making sure they are in a single layer. Cook for about 5-6 minutes, or until the croutons turn golden brown and crispy.
After they are done, remove the croissant croutons from the air fryer and let them cool for a few minutes. They will become even crispier as they cool down.
Finally, sprinkle the croissant croutons over your favorite salad, soup, or pasta dish. They add a delightful crunch and a rich, buttery flavor that will elevate your dish to a whole new level. Enjoy!
